Creating a mood is an often overlooked aspect of interior design by many people. Different rooms require a different mood, so take this into consideration before designing. As an example, for a cool and tranquil mood, pick colors that are in the soft blue family.

Mixing textures and patterns can add visual and tactile interest to a room. This type of variety adds detail to your rooms and helps to accent different objects throughout it. If you want your space to look more modern, textures and patterns can help.

When choosing furniture to place in a small room, look for pieces that have versatility. You can use an ottoman as a chair or a makeshift table. An ottoman used in this way can provide extra seating or a table surface in a cramped area. Dual purpose items are very practical and can save a lot of money.

Be creative when using framed pictures. Keep in mind that pictures are included in the design of your rooms. You do not need to have them hang in only straight lines. You could hang them at angles or in thought-out patterns. You can really use the white space around your home to make it look livelier.

Consider using glass doors rather than the traditional wood doors so that your kitchen can open up and appear brighter. You can even add accent pieces in the open glass cabinets to give a nice visual appearance.

It is a good idea to invest in paint; a paint that is high-quality is suggested. Cheap paint wears away and may harm walls, which can cost you tons of money. Choosing a higher quality paint is worth the investment.

If you intend to change the interior design of your home, stick with the basics. Add some personalty but don’t pick loud or overly trendy designs. You will have to live with your choices for years. If you want to sell your house, extremely loud decor could repulse new buyers. Updating your home’s accessories is a great interior design tip. Replacement lighting fixtures and ceramic pieces can upgrade the look of your room. Add some new curtains or tea towels in a room. A few easy changes, such as these, can give rooms a fresh, new look without breaking your wallet.

Living room furniture does not allows need to face the television. It is always nice to have a conversation area or an additional spot to sit in away from the noise of the television. This will be a nice place to relax and converse with a friend over a cup of tea.

Eliminate clutter and over-sized furniture from small rooms. Find pretty ways to hide your stuff in storage to de-clutter a room. Put all of the miscellaneous toys and papers sitting around into storage. By adding a simply bin over in the corner you can clear up a lot of clutter.
